How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Tillsonburg?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Tillsonburg Studio Apartments | $1,414 | $1,049 | $1,695 |
| Tillsonburg 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,665 | $1,099 | $3,015 |
| Tillsonburg 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,143 | $1,225 | $3,295 |
| Tillsonburg 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,586 | $1,842 | $3,895 |
| Tillsonburg 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,234 | $929 | $2,250 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Tillsonburg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Tillsonburg with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Tillsonburg is at 939 Western listed at $1,842.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Tillsonburg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Tillsonburg is $2,586.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Tillsonburg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Tillsonburg is a 1,962 square feet unit starting from $3,495 at 180 Mill Street.
What is the average size for Tillsonburg 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Tillsonburg is currently 1,100 sq ft.
